Default Pro Tools skipping bars

Hi.

I'm having a problem in PT LE. When I import a midi drum file for a song into PT, it skips bars 26 + 27. I can select them, but they don't show on the ruler and it messes up the click, which makes it almost impossible to record to. Any ideas how to fix it?

It's not skipping the notes, it still plays them. It looks like this:

http://img532.imageshack.us/img532/9859/protools.jpg

I zoomed in and the bars re-appear, but there's something wonky with bar 26. Any Ideas?

I fixed it, there was some meter changes that were screwing things up.
